Yarn price hike slammed
KARACHI: Pakistan Yarn Merchant Association (PYMA) on Tuesday demanded of the government to rein in an uncontrolled increase in the prices of yarn and save the local industry from going down as it was hanging by a thread.
“Due to the unavailability of yarn raw material according to the local demand, domestic filament yarn producers are getting undue advantage of regulatory duty imposed on imported polyester fibre,” Khurshid A Shaikh, central chairman PYMA said in a statement.
“As a result, yarn prices have gone through the roof and domestic polyester fabric industry is on the edge closing down.”
Shaikh said domestic yarn manufacturers did not have the capacity to meet local demand due to which industries were forced to depend on imported raw material.
“In spite of low production capacity of domestic yarn makers, imposition of 5 percent regulatory duty on imported polyester yarn is undecipherable and will destroy the national weaving/knitting industries,” he said adding that it had made the cost of imported yarn unbearably high.
The PYMA office bearer further said the duty on imported polyester filament yarn was higher than imported polyester fabric, which was against the law and had devastated the whole polyester chain cascading system.
“Polyester filament yarn is not a luxury item but only a raw material,” he said. He said the government should reduce the duties/taxes on imported filament yarn to save local industry from total collapse.
“Beside this, anti dumping duty on imported filament yarn must be suspended until industry achieves production capacity to fulfill national demand,” he said.
